Job Summary

  • Independently conducts analytical and operational activities in support of complex state or federally funded health initiatives.
  • Develops and maintains recurring reporting products and structured documentation aligned with state and federal grant requirements.
  • Translates qualitative and quantitative data into clear, actionable narratives for internal leadership and external stakeholders.

Skills & Requirements

Must-have

  • Program performance monitoring
  • Grant requirements documentation
  • Financial and performance data reconciliation
  • Actionable narrative development
  • Procurement tracking systems
  • Operational risk identification

Nice-to-have

  • Collaboration across workstreams
  • Compliance-driven environments
  • High-volume implementation settings

Key Requirements

  • Bachelor's degree required
  • Minimum 4 years experience
  • Experience supporting grant-funded programs
  • Experience preparing structured reports
  • Experience reconciling financial data
  • Ability to manage multiple workflows

Work Rights

Must live in Texas
